
SAT Subject Tests
SAT Subject Tests were standardized exams in specific academic subjects, such as math, science, languages, and history, that allowed students to showcase their knowledge and skills in these areas. Each test assessed a student's understanding beyond the general SAT exam, targeting high school curriculum content. Colleges often used these scores for admissions, particularly for programs requiring specialized knowledge. However, as of 2021, the College Board discontinued SAT Subject Tests, reflecting changes in college admissions practices and an increasing emphasis on a more holistic evaluation of student applications.
